Москва

ruru

Вверх

courses
Разработка 2D и 3D-игр в Godot на Python

Разработка 2D и 3D-игр в Godot на Python

По данным Google игровая индустрия - одна из самых популярных сфер, которая выросла за последнее время на 23,1% и продолжает расти. В наше время профессиональные разработчики игр и приложений - очень востребованная и перспективная специальность.

Еще недавно разработка компьютерных игр считалась исключительно профессиональной сферой деятельности небольшого круга компаний, но с развитием современных технологий все резко изменилось! Разработка игр стала более доступна, чем когда-либо. Теперь создать собственную игру под силу каждому, в том числе и ребенку!

Сейчас практически каждый ребенок увлечен компьютерными играми и тратит на них свое свободное время, а некоторые ребята мечтают создавать свои собственные шедевры.  Благодаря изучению такого перспективного направления, как разработка игр, маленький программист уже не будет тратить время впустую - он научится разрабатывать, программировать и создавать собственные игровые вселенные!

Если вашим детям интересны компьютерные игры или информационные технологии, запишите их на курс «Разработка 2D и 3D-игр в Godot на Python», где они научатся программировать, создавая собственные игры.

Кому подойдет курс по Godot Engine?

  • Новичкам, желающим создавать собственные игры
  • Новичкам, у кого нет специальных навыков и опыта в программировании
  • Любящим играть в игры на компьютере
  • Интересующимся 2D и 3D программированием
  • Ребятам, окончившим курсы «Боты на Python» и «Программирование игр на Python» 
  • Желающим продолжить развивать свои навыки программирования на Python 
  • Ребятам, желающим научиться создавать свои 2D и 3D-игры и начать программировать на Python

Содержание курса:

  • Знакомство с Godot и основами интерфейса
  • Создание 2D-игры «Платформер»
  • Монеты и UI
  • Враги и порталы
  • Пули и жизни
  • Зелья и powerup’ы
  • Предметы и инвентарь
  • NPC и диалоги
  • Знакомство с 3D
  • Физика в Godot
  • Terrain. Формирование ландшафта
  • NPC и враги в 3D
  • Создание оружия и пуль
  • UI в 3D играх
  • Добавление звукового оформления в игру
  • Визуальное оформление и работа со светом
  • Подготовка к созданию хоррора
  • Создание хоррора
  • Доработка хоррора
  • Улучшение хоррора
  • Подготовка к созданию игры Гонки
  • Физика и UI в гонках
  • Поведение соперников и финиш
  • Создание магазина для покупки улучшений
  • Возвращение в 2D и создание игры JRPG
  • Создание локаций в стиле JRPG
  • Добавление инвентаря, сундуков и собираемых предметов
  • Создание магазинов
  • Крафтинг и улучшение инвентаря и аксессуаров
  • Боевая система и враги
  • Система развития персонажа
  • Экспорт игры и публикация на хостинг
  • Написание сценария новой игры
  • Создание новых локаций
  • Подготовка к защите проектов
  • Защита проекта

Цели курса по Годот 4:

  • Познакомиться с программой Godot.
  • Изучить программирование на языке Gdscript.
  • Дать полное и всестороннее понимание того, как работает игра и как она устроена внутри.
  • Провести детей от интереса просто играть в компьютерные игры до желания их создавать и развиваться в дальнейшем в сфере IT. 

О курсе:

В процессе обучения на русском языке ребята работают с Godot Engine, профессиональным игровым движком с унифицированным интерфейсом для создания как 2D, так и 3D-игр, который поддерживает большинство языков программирования благодаря своей открытости.

Этот движок поставляется с языком программирования под названием GDScript, в основе которого лежит Python. Многие разработчики, начинающие с Godot, были приятно удивлены тем, насколько быстро освоился язык. Именно поэтому наш курс подходит как новичкам, так и ребятам, знакомым с основами программирования.

Мы изучим особенности и возможности движка Godot, научимся разрабатывать игры, используя его язык программирования GDScript, получим навыки работы в команде, создадим собственные миры и многое другое.

Обучение начинается с изучения программы Годот и заканчивается публикацией собственных проектов. Таким образом, ребята не только научатся создавать 2D и 3D-игры, но и смогут делиться ими.

В процессе обучения развивается креативное мышление ребят, что способствует генерации множества идей для сюжетов к своим работам, созданию уникальных миров и проработке захватывающего места действия.

Так как в основе изученного на курсе языка программирования лежит Python, ученик познакомится с его синтаксисом и ему будет легче в дальнейшем программировать на данном языке.

По окончании курса у ученика будет сформировано портфолио из проектов, созданных за весь курс.

Преимущества Godot Engine

  1. Godot полностью бесплатен, в отличие от Unity, в котором существуют ограничения в бесплатной версии. Godot имеет открытый исходный код под очень либеральной лицензией MIT. Никаких условий, никаких гонораров, ничего. Ваша игра принадлежит вам до последней строчки кода движка.

  2. Кросс-платформенное редактирование и публикация. У Godot есть соответствующая версия редактора для каждой операционной системы: Windows, Mac и Linux.

  3. Система анимации Godot - одна из самых мощных и простых в использовании систем.

  4. Количество языков. В отличие от Unity, который использует только C#, Godot позволяет писать игры на языке программирования GDScript, основанном на Python, а также на C++, D, Rust и C#.

  5. Интуитивно понятная система узлов. В Godot есть система визуальных сценариев с использованием блоков, которые можно соединять, что делает его доступным для новичков. Вы можете просто перетаскивать любую информацию, используя узлы и сцены.

  6. Godot - один из самых простейших игровых движков в плане написания кода.

Перед началом работы в Unity мы рекомендуем познакомиться с Godot Engine, так как он проще для ребят, не имеющих никаких знаний и навыков в разработке игр, в плане интерфейса и отдельных механик. GDScript создан специально для написания коротких и простых сценариев для игр на движке Godot. Программируя на нем ученику будет гораздо легче понять логику объектно-ориентированного программирования и приступить к работе с другими игровыми движками и изучению более сложных языков программирования.

В рамках курса Ваш ребенок: 

  • изучит профессиональный язык программирования GDScript;
  • научится работать в игровом движке Godot;
  • получит навыки разработки 2D и 3D-игр;
  • создаст несколько собственных игровых проектов;
  • научится разбираться в фундаментальных концепциях и правилах программирования.

Что нужно для занятий?

  • Для прохождения курса ребенку потребуется компьютер/ноутбук с установленными на него программами.

Если занятия онлайн: 

  • Доступ к интернету (проверьте стабильность интернет-соединения, от 20 Мбит/сек).
  • Наушники, а также дополнительное оборудование для лучшего качества звука: микрофон или гарнитуру.

Системные требования к компьютеру:

Просьба убедиться, что Ваш компьютер подходит для курса. Рекомендации по ссылке

Инструкция по установке программ для курса:

Скачать по ссылке.

Преимущества обучения Godot в Coddy

Выбрав курс по Годот в Coddy, вы обеспечите своему ребенку следующие преимущества:

  • Удобное время и место занятий. Если ребенок слишком загружен посещением иных секций, то у нас есть решение — занятия в формате онлайн. Вы сэкономите время и силы, а ученик сможет добиваться прогресса в обучении Godot Engine везде, где есть доступ к интернету.

  • Обучение с интересом. Преподаватели используют современные интерактивные методики, что позволяет мотивировать учащихся на посещение курсов по Godot Engine.

  • Индивидуальный подход к каждому. Программа обучения создана таким образом, чтобы раскрывать особенности ребенка и развивать его сильные стороны.

  • Гарантированный результат. Проходя обучение Godot на русском, ребенок получит мощную базу навыков, которые помогут ему развиваться в дальнейшем в сфере IT.

Воспользуйтесь преимуществами курса по Годот 4 для того, чтобы эффективно развить способности своего ребенка.

Как записаться на курсы Godot в Coddy

Записаться на курсы Годот просто. Для этого нужно:

  • позвонить по указанным на сайте номерам телефонов;
  • написать в WhatsApp;
  • оставить заявку на обратный звонок — менеджер перезвонит вам в течение нескольких минут и согласует все нюансы сотрудничества.

Сегодня этот курс просматривали5 человек(-а)
Разработка 2D и 3D-игр в Godot на Python

Возраст:11-16 лет

Уровень:

для новичков и продолжающих

Длительность:

от 9 модулей (месяцев), от 72 часов*.Примечание: программа и длительность курса не являются публичной офертой и могут быть скорректированы в ходе обучения в зависимости от темпа занятий, уровня усвоения материала студентами и по усмотрению преподавателя для обеспечения наилучших результатов обучения.

Формат:

индивидуальные и групповые занятия, офлайн и онлайн (в режиме реального времени).

Программа:

здесьПримечание: программа и длительность курса не являются публичной офертой и могут быть скорректированы в ходе обучения в зависимости от темпа занятий, уровня усвоения материала студентами и по усмотрению преподавателя для обеспечения наилучших результатов обучения.

Количество детей:

от 1 до 8

Расписание

Пройди этот тест и узнай, нужен ли тебе курс«Разработка 2D и 3D-игр в Godot на Python» или ты уже все знаешь

Преподаватели

Наши занятия

Занимайся в CODDY и получай подарки за достижения!

Занятия в CODDY состоят из 30 уровней, по достижению каждого из них юный коддик получает сертификат.

Собери их все!

За достижение 5-го уровня каждый коддик получает фирменный CODDY браслет, за 10-й уровень – фирменные стикер-паки CODDY! Достигнув 15-го уровня, он получит стильный CODDY блокнот, а на 20-м уровне — фирменную толстовку CODDY. Но и это еще не все! На 25-м уровне юный программист получит удобный рюкзак CODDY! А на 30-м уровне – индивидуальный CODDY подарок!

А также добавляйте стикеры себе в мессенджерах и пользуйтесь в социальных сетях совершенно бесплатно!

Для Instagram: для сториз вбейте в поиск "coddy", и вы найдете множество разных стикеров, а также гифок!

Разбавьте свое общение в мессенджерах!WhatsApp на Android: скачать стикеры бесплатно по по ссылке.

WhatsApp iOs: мы работаем над этим и скоро у яблочных пользователей также будут стикеры!

Для Viber: скачать бесплатно по по ссылке.

Для Telegram: скачать бесплатно по по ссылке. Если у вас нет телеграм, то вы можете самостоятельно его установить на свое устройство, следуя инструкции.

Площадки
Бонусы от друзей !
Подпишитесь на новости и получите бонусы от наших партнеров

Спасибо!
Заявка успешно отправлена!
Возникла ошибка. Сообщите, пожалуйста, администратору.
Вы отправили много заявок. Попробуйте позже
Ваше имя и фамилия *
Обязательно
Имя ребенка*
Обязательно
Возраст ребенка*
лет
Обязательно
E-mail*
Введен не верный e-mail
Ваш город
Обязательно
Запишите ребенка
на бесплатный урок!
Спасибо!
Заявка успешно отправлена!
Возникла ошибка. Сообщите, пожалуйста, администратору.
Вы отправили много заявок. Попробуйте позже
Обязательно
Введен не верный e-mail
+7
Обязательно
Промокод не применен
Промокод применен
Пробное занятие
Спасибо!
Заявка успешно отправлена!
Возникла ошибка. Сообщите, пожалуйста, администратору.
Вы отправили много заявок. Попробуйте позже
Ваше имя и фамилия
Обязательно
Ваш e-mail
Введен не верный e-mail
Ваш телефон
+7
Обязательно
Промокод
Промокод не применен
Промокод применен
Связаться с нами
Спасибо!
Заявка успешно отправлена!
Возникла ошибка. Сообщите, пожалуйста, администратору.
Вы отправили много заявок. Попробуйте позже
Обнаружены недопустимые символы в сообщении. Уберите все лишнее, оставьте только текст.
Ваше имя и фамилия
Обязательно
Ваш город
Обязательно
Ваш e-mail
Введен не верный e-mail
Сообщение
Обязательно
Предварительная запись
Спасибо!
Заявка успешно отправлена!
Возникла ошибка. Сообщите, пожалуйста, администратору.
Вы отправили много заявок. Попробуйте позже
Ваше имя и фамилия
Обязательно
Имя ребенка
Обязательно
Ваш город
Обязательно
Ваш телефон
Обязательно
Ваш e-mail
Введен не верный e-mail
Начало обучения
Май 2025
Июнь 2025
Июль 2025
Заказать звонок
Администратор свяжется с
вами в ближайшее время.
Что-то пошло не так, попробуйте отправить заявку позже.
Вы отправили много заявок. Попробуйте позже
Ваше имя и фамилия
Обязательно
Ваш телефон
+7
Обязательно
Оставить заявку
Администратор свяжется с
вами в ближайшее время.
Что-то пошло не так, попробуйте отправить заявку позже.
Вы отправили много заявок. Попробуйте позже
Ваше имя и фамилия
Обязательно
Ваш телефон
Обязательно
Оплатить курсы
Заявка подана, менеджер свяжется с вами в ближайшее время!
Получите бонус от наших партнеров.
Возникла ошибка. Сообщите, пожалуйста, администратору.
Вы отправили много заявок. Попробуйте позже
Имя и фамилия ребенка
Обязательно
Ваш телефон
Обязательно
Ваш e-mail
Введен не верный e-mail
Сумма для оплаты
Введите целое число
Оставить отзыв
Благодарим вас за отзыв.
Что-то пошло не так, попробуйте отправить заявку позже.
Вы отправили много заявок. Попробуйте позже
Ваше имя и фамилия
Обязательно
Ваш e-mail
Введен не верный e-mail
Ваше фото
Оцените школу
Оцените преподавателя
Отзыв
Обязательно
Спасибо!
Заявка успешно отправлена!
Close
По записи и другим вопросам звоните по номеру телефона +7 (495) 106-60-11 или пишите на email info@coddyschool.com
Close
Close
Выберите языкChoose a languageТілді таңдаңызВиберіть мовуSélectionnez la langueSprache wählen
Choose a language
RU
EN
KZ
UA
FR
DE
OK
Предварительный просмотр
Заберите индивидуальный план развития ребенка
Заберите индивидуальный
план развития ребенка